Al Roker Makes First Today Show Appearance Since Prostate Surgery

  • Al Roker appeared on NBC's Today show Tuesday for the first time since revealing that he'd been diagnosed with prostate cancer in order to give his colleagues and viewers an update on his progress after having a five-hour surgery.

    "I got some good news," Roker said about his trip to the doctor, before playing a montage about his journey that included his surgeons saying he's showing no evidence of any further cancer, but that they will continue to monitor that over the next several years.

    He did mention that he felt better after this surgery than he did for any of his joint replacements, but that he's got some swelling around his waist going on that makes him feel like "Bibendum, the Michelin Man."

    The fact that he knows The Michelin Man's real name is just one reason why we love Al Roker. He said he hopes to return to the show next week.
